perf ui tui: Move progress.c under ui/tui directory
authorNamhyung Kim <namhyung.kim@lge.com>
Tue, 13 Nov 2012 13:30:31 +0000 (22:30 +0900)
committerArnaldo Carvalho de Melo <acme@redhat.com>
Wed, 14 Nov 2012 19:52:33 +0000 (16:52 -0300)
Current ui_progress functions are implemented for TUI only.  So move the
file under the tui directory.  This is needed for providing an UI-
agnostic wrapper.
